Sex attack on woman, 27, at Warrington

0

POLICE at Warrington are appealing for help from the public following an attempted sex attack in the town.
A 27-year-old woman was grabbed from behind in the early hours of the morning by a man who tried to drag her into a secluded area.
But a local resident intervened and the offender fled leaving the woman with cuts and grazes to her shoulder and ankle. But she did not require hospital treatment.
The attack took place at about 4.45 on Sunday, June 28, in Knutsford Road, closed to its junction with Barry Street.
The attacker was about 5ft 9 inches tall, of medium build in his late twenties or early thirties. He was clean shaven with short black, wavy gelled hair. He was wearing blue jeans, with a red tracksuit top with white stripes down the arms and a white motif on the chest.
DC Elaine Flynn from Warrington CID said: “We are currently following up a number of lines of enquiry and are keen to speak to anyone who is able to assist with our investigation.
“I would also like to remind all local residents in the area to be vigilant and exercise caution and stay with friends when out at night.”
Anyone with any information is asked to contact Cheshire Police on 101 quoting incident number 259 of 28/6/2015. Alternatively information can be reported anonymously to Crimestoppers on 0800 555 111.
